Transaction 6e56d62f9cb8f329837f1228e94e2de3d9e53fbbcb73ea0a8d0a65674b6160c0

block
f6e435a35d16fbc0f07502b037f6b9423de21e0b42b3b4d93f4652797c833f64

1 Input

23 Outputs